Sean ‘Diddy’ Combs’ daughters who are twins, have set aside their father’s legal troubles to enjoy themselves at their high school prom night. They were seen dancing in matching dresses, looking glamorous for the evening.

Jessie and D’Lila, both 17 years old, were captured in photos being swept off their feet by their dates, who were elegantly dressed. The teens wore stunning identical red gowns, adding to the elegance of the evening.

The Combs twins joined their classmates at the Great Gatsby themed party on Saturday amid their dad’s sex trafficking trial.

Despite the challenges their father is facing legally, the twin daughters have been by his side during his court appearances. However, on their prom night, they were the center of attention as they were escorted to their transport in style.

A source told DailyMail.com that the twins are not expected to return to their father’s trial until after their upcoming graduation.

They are seniors at Sierra Canyon School in Los Angeles with their graduation scheduled for May 22.

Exclusive DailyMail.com photographs show the teens stunning as they enjoyed their prom, temporarily escaping the media frenzy surrounding their father’s legal troubles.

The twins recently admitted the past couple of years have been ‘extremely difficult’ since he was arrested for a string of depraved crimes.
